In Epistle to the Philippians 3:10–21, Paul the Apostle expresses his deep desire to know Jesus Christ more fully—not only through His resurrection power but also through sharing in His sufferings and becoming like Him in His death.Paul makes it clear that he has not yet reached spiritual perfection. Instead, he describes the Christian life as a race, continually pressing forward toward the goal for which Christ has called him. He refuses to dwell on the past and keeps his focus on the future prize found in Christ.Paul then contrasts two ways of living: those whose minds are set on earthly things and those whose true citizenship is in heaven. Believers are called to live with an eternal perspective, eagerly awaiting the return of Christ, who will transform their humble bodies to be like His glorious resurrected body.
